    Discover the hidden potential of a career in construction with Ken Simonson, Chief Economist at Associated General Contractors of America. With over 22 years of industry experience, Ken offers invaluable insights into the current economic landscape affecting the construction sector, from labor supply challenges to material costs. Broadcasting from Wichita, Kansas, he draws upon his diverse background, including his time at the Office of Advocacy US Small Business Administration and the American Trucking Associations, to provide a comprehensive view of the opportunities and challenges in construction today.

    Learn why high school graduates should seriously consider a career in construction, where the average hourly wage outpaces the broader private sector by 19%. Ken also highlights the transformative power of cutting-edge technology, such as drones, 3D printing, and AI, and how these innovations are revolutionizing the way construction work is done, providing a sense of tangible accomplishment and long-term satisfaction.

    Get a deeper understanding of the importance of teamwork and safety in the construction field, and how these elements contribute to job satisfaction and skill development. We discuss the diverse range of roles available, emphasizing that the industry values various skills from on-site manual labor to off-site coordination. Ken also touches on the need for a national accreditation system to elevate the status of construction professionals, making the field more appealing to young people and their parents. Additionally, we tackle the pressing issues of labor costs, regulatory challenges, and the potential for productivity gains through technology to make housing more affordable and sustainable.

    Our returning guest, Geoff Krahn, shares the latest on his innovative venture, Reveloper. This groundbreaking platform equips small landowners, especially those in the industrial sector, with tools traditionally reserved for big developers. By simplifying the entire development process—from feasibility studies to construction planning—Reveloper empowers landowners to make informed decisions and maximize their investments. Jeff explains how even those with little to no real estate background can compete with larger players, revolutionizing the landscape of property development.
